One of the most entertaining things about teaching 8th grade science is the comments that kids make. For example, I've given the class an assignment to complete, and I look up a few minutes later to see a student turned Sideways in his seat, book closed, head in his hands. “Ted?” I asked. “What are you doing?” He looks up sleepily and replies, “I’m thinking.”
Interesting. It gives one pause. Maybe I need to think more when playing poker. Do you like the segue?
I’ve been involved in an on-going experiment with my poker playing. I will sit down at a $.50/$1 Omaha hi/lo game and will play it until I am up $6, and then take the money and enter a $5 Sit-and-go as a freeroll. It’s been a good system and I am continually in the black playing on the three sites that I currently frequent. My goal however has always been to be able to make some real (whatever that means) money playing poker and so that means I will have to eventually move up in levels.
I think my biggest obstacle remains the fact I don’t like to lose, especially when money is concerned. How do I overcome this obstacle?
I’m thinking….
